Jonathan Franzen's Imaginary Friend

New York Press | December 1, 2004
The novelist's fine essay in the Nov. 29 issue of The New Yorker is about the comic strip "Peanuts" and his own depressing childhood. How many people would admit to identifying with the loser Charlie Brown?
